Recent version of U-Boot use binman to provide a mechanism for building images, from simple SPL + U-Boot combinations, to more complex arrangements with many parts. As for U-boot package, this tool uses additional host python modules that must be provided by Buildroot. So introduce a new option BR2_TARGET_TI_K3_R5_LOADER_USE_BINMAN to add additional host packages in U-Boot build dependency to use binman. The binman requirement is directly included in buildman dependency (tools/buildman/requirements.txt) since within U-Boot, binman is invoked by the build system, here buildman [1]. Make sure that all binman requirements are build before ti-k3-r5-loader.
